Discovery Notes | General location is RiverPark Place Marina, green area near apartments. Curbside under a tree. Ohio River flooding zone, flooded soil one day prior. Collected soaked soil. In winter (time of year sample was collected in) people interaction not common. |
Naming Notes | Name "Komet" was chosen because it is how you write comet in my native Slovenian language. The first time plaques were observed it looked like the turbidity was present only on one side, making it look like a comet. It was later decided tail was observed due to experiment error, it wasn't observed later on other plaques. |
